The Rise of Tabletop RPGs: Why They’re More Popular Than Ever

Tabletop role-playing games (RPGs) have experienced a renaissance in recent years. Once relegated to niche groups and basements, they now thrive in living rooms, cafes, and even online platforms. So, what’s driving this surge in popularity? Let’s unpack the factors contributing to the rise of tabletop RPGs and why they resonate with a diverse audience.

The Community Aspect

At the heart of tabletop RPGs is community. Unlike many video games that emphasize solitary play, tabletop RPGs require a group of players to collaborate, strategize, and narrate their stories together. This social interaction fosters friendships and strengthens bonds, creating a sense of belonging that many people crave.

In recent years, platforms like Twitch and YouTube have showcased live sessions, allowing viewers to witness the dynamics of these games. The accessibility of watching others play has inspired many to join in themselves. Whether it’s a casual game night with friends or a large online campaign, the social aspect is undeniably appealing.

Creative Expression

Tabletop RPGs are a canvas for creativity. Players can build their characters, design intricate backstories, and influence plotlines. Each session becomes a collaborative storytelling experience that allows participants to explore different facets of their imagination.

This freedom to create and express oneself is liberating. Players often find themselves stepping into roles they wouldn’t typically explore in their daily lives. This form of escapism not only entertains but also fosters emotional growth and self-discovery.

The Influence of Pop Culture

The rise of tabletop RPGs can also be attributed to their increasing presence in mainstream media. Popular shows like “Stranger Things” and “Critical Role” have highlighted the excitement and camaraderie of these games. Such portrayals make the concept more approachable for newcomers.

Moreover, the integration of RPG elements in video games and television has blurred the lines between different types of storytelling. Many players now seek out tabletop RPGs as a natural extension of the narratives they love in other mediums.

Accessibility and Resources

The growth of online resources has made it easier than ever to get started with tabletop RPGs. Numerous websites offer free guides, character sheets, and campaign materials. This accessibility lowers barriers to entry. Aspiring players don’t need to invest heavily in books or materials. With just a handful of online resources, they can dive into their first game and experience the thrill of role-playing.

Variety of Games

Another reason for the resurgence of tabletop RPGs is the sheer variety of games available. While Dungeons & Dragons often takes the spotlight, numerous other systems cater to different interests and themes. From horror to sci-fi to historical settings, there’s something for everyone.

This diversity allows players to choose a game that resonates with their interests, encouraging them to explore new genres and styles. As players become more engaged, they often branch out into other systems, further expanding the tabletop RPG community.

The Role of Technology

Technology has played a significant role in making tabletop RPGs more popular. Virtual tabletops (VTTs) like Roll20 and Foundry allow players to connect from anywhere in the world. These platforms provide tools for easy character management, map-building, and real-time gameplay. They bridge the gap between in-person and online gaming, making it possible for friends separated by miles to continue their campaigns.

The use of digital tools doesn’t stop at VTTs. Apps and websites offer character sheets, dice rollers, and campaign management, enhancing the overall experience. These advancements help streamline gameplay and make it more enjoyable for both new and seasoned players.

Embracing Inclusivity

Inclusivity has become a cornerstone of the tabletop RPG community. Many groups actively strive to create welcoming environments for players of all backgrounds, genders, and orientations. This focus on diversity has made the hobby more appealing to a broader audience.

Game developers are increasingly aware of the need for representation in their narratives and systems. This shift not only enriches the stories told but also invites more people to join in, fostering a sense of community among players who may have previously felt excluded.
